Can I do a quick claim deed on someone who has not paid the property taxes can I file a quit claim deed if I paid the taxes should I file for a quick claim deed?

A quit claim deed transfers ownership rights in a property but does not address any unpaid property taxes or other liens. If you have paid the property taxes, you may have a claim for reimbursement, but merely filing a quit claim deed will not resolve the tax issue. It's essential to consult with a legal professional to understand your rights and obligations before proceeding. If you're looking to formalize ownership, ensure all tax and ownership issues are resolved first.

In ohio if i sign a quick claim deed to land and a house when my name is on the loan what exactly does this mean for me?

In Ohio, signing a quick claim deed to land and a house when your name is on the loan will still make you legally responsible for the loan.
